Company registration is a fiercely competitive arena. Yet one with surprisingly little in the way of formal professional monitoring. ACRA, the Association of Company Registration Agents, was established to encourage high standards amongst agents and to act as an open forum for those involved in the industry.

The only recognised trade association for company registration. ACRA works closely with various Government departments including Companies House, HM Treasury, BEIS, and HMRC.

Membership of ACRA acts an endorsement of the quality of the service you provide and gives customers confidence that they are dealing with people they can trust. It’s no coincidence that our membership base accounts for over half of all UK company registrations carried out in the private sector.
